Summary

Justice Pariente dissents, arguing that before the 2010 Mark Wandall Traffic Safety Act the Florida Legislature had not expressly preempted municipal red‑light camera programs and that the ordinances enacted by Orlando and Aventura were valid exercises of home‑rule authority. The dissent maintains that the statutes authorizing traffic regulation by municipalities include the power to use cameras and impose civil penalties, and that no conflict preemption exists.
